Help Catalania : European parliament vicepresident asks that Spain authorize Catalan referendum

Madrid has to leave the decision in the hands of the Catalan people,” says the German liberal Alexander Álvaro.
One of the European parliament vice-presidents, Germany’s Liberal Party Alexander Álvaro, asked that Spain authorize a referendum about Catalonia’s independence. Speaking on RAC1 (a radio station in Catalonia,) Alexander Álvaro said that no government should work against the will of the people, and that Catalans have to have right to vote, although he personally doesn’t “understand the reasons why Catalans want to be independent.” “If Catalans think that is the right approach, Madrid has to leave the decision in the hands of the Catalan people,” he added.
“I think it isn't very positive that the Government is trying to interfere with the right of the Catalans to decide for themselves,” added Alexander Álvaro. He also pointed out that a government “should never force a decision on the people whether they want it or not.”
